版本服务器关闭是什么
-
版本服务器关闭是指一种服务器在被关闭之前,将当前正在运行的软件或操作系统的状态保存下来,以便下次启动时可以快速恢复到上一次关闭时的状态。这种功能可以提供更加可靠和稳定的服务器运行环境,并减少因突发情况或人为错误引起的数据丢失和系统崩溃的风险。
版本服务器关闭主要基于以下几个原理:
- 内存快照:在关闭服务器之前,会将当前内存中的数据和状态保存到磁盘上,以便在下次启动服务器时可以将这些数据加载到内存中,恢复到关闭前的状态。
- 事务日志:服务器会将当前正在执行的事务操作记录到日志文件中,当服务器重新启动时,会通过恢复日志将这些操作重新执行一遍,从而确保数据的一致性。
- 磁盘快照:服务器会对磁盘上的数据进行快照,将当前的数据状态保存起来,以便下次启动时可以还原到这个状态。
版本服务器关闭的好处包括:
- 数据保护:服务器关闭前会将内存中的数据和磁盘上的数据保存下来,避免因突发情况导致的数据丢失。
- 系统可靠性:通过版本服务器关闭,可以确保服务器在重新启动后能够恢复到上一次关闭前的状态,减少系统崩溃的风险。
- 效率提升:版本服务器关闭可以帮助服务器在下次启动时更快地回到正常工作状态,减少启动时间和系统恢复的开销。
总之,版本服务器关闭是一种通过保存当前状态和数据的技术手段,用于提供更加可靠和稳定的服务器运行环境。它对于保护数据、提高系统可靠性和提升服务器效率都起到了积极的作用。
1年前 -
版本服务器关闭是指某个软件或系统的版本服务器停止运行或关闭的情况。版本服务器是用于分发和管理软件或系统的新版本的服务器,它可以提供软件安装包的下载、更新和升级等功能。当版本服务器关闭时,将会对用户和开发者造成一些影响。
以下是版本服务器关闭可能引起的影响:
-
无法下载新版本:关闭版本服务器意味着无法从服务器上下载新的软件版本。这会对用户造成一定困扰,特别是对那些希望及时获取新功能或修复bug的用户来说。
-
更新和升级受阻:版本服务器关闭后,无法进行软件的更新和升级。这将使用户无法获得已修复的漏洞或增加的功能,可能会导致软件在安全性和功能上滞后。
-
不可靠的软件分发:版本服务器负责分发软件安装包,关闭后,软件的分发可能会变得不可靠。用户可能无法通过官方渠道获得正版软件,从而被迫寻找其他不安全或不可靠的渠道,增加了受到恶意软件感染的风险。
-
开发者困境:版本服务器关闭对开发者来说也是一个挑战。他们将失去一个提供软件更新的重要渠道,无法将新的功能和修复应用到用户手中,影响软件的发展和用户体验。
-
难以维护旧版本:关闭版本服务器还意味着较旧版本的软件将难以获得支持和维护。如果用户在服务器关闭前没有下载和保存旧版本的软件安装包,他们可能无法获得后续的修复和支持,可能会面临安全和稳定性问题。
总而言之,版本服务器的关闭将对用户和开发者产生一定的影响,包括无法及时获得新版本、难以更新和升级、不可靠的软件分发、开发困境和维护旧版本困难等。因此,对于软件和系统的开发者来说,保持版本服务器的稳定运行是至关重要的。
1年前 -
-
关闭版本服务器是指停止运行版本服务器,即停止提供版本管理服务的服务器。版本服务器一般指的是用于版本控制的中央服务器,例如GIT、SVN等。关闭版本服务器可能会影响团队协作和代码管理工作,因此在关闭之前需要考虑各种因素并采取相应的措施。下面是关闭版本服务器的一般操作流程和注意事项。
-
通知团队成员:在关闭版本服务器之前,需要提前通知团队中的成员。通知的内容应包括关闭的时间、关闭的原因以及对于团队成员的影响等。确保每个成员都能及时知悉,以便做好相应的准备工作。
-
备份数据:在关闭版本服务器之前,一定要对其中的数据进行备份。这样即使关闭后需要重新启用版本服务器,也可以从备份中恢复数据,避免数据的丢失。
-
通知其他相关系统:如果版本服务器与其他系统有集成,例如构建系统、自动化测试系统等,需要提前通知相关负责人关闭集成,以避免因为版本服务器关闭而导致这些系统无法正常工作。
-
停用相关服务:关闭版本服务器之前,需要停用相关的服务。这包括停止版本控制系统的服务进程,以及停止版本控制系统与其他系统的通信。停用服务的方式可以使用系统命令或者管理员工具,具体根据版本控制系统的不同而定。
-
关闭服务器:最后一步是关闭版本服务器。关闭服务器的方式根据具体服务器的类型而定。对于单机服务器,可以通过关闭服务器进程或者关闭服务器的操作系统来实现。对于网络服务器,可以通过关闭服务器所在的虚拟机或者关闭服务器所在的物理机来实现。
在关闭版本服务器之后,对于团队成员来说可能需要调整工作流程和代码管理方式,例如使用本地版本控制或者将代码托管到其他云端版本控制平台。确保团队成员能够适应新的工作方式,并及时备份和管理代码,以确保代码的安全和高效的团队协作。
1年前 -